Home Skylight Replacement in Bellevue, WA
Home skylight replacement services involve removing an existing skylight and installing a new unit to restore or improve natural light and ventilation in a property. These projects typically address issues such as leaks, drafts, or damage to the current skylight, as well as upgrades for better energy efficiency or aesthetic appeal. Property owners often request this service when their current skylight has become cracked, cloudy, or no longer functions properly, or when they wish to enhance the appearance and value of their home through upgraded design options.
Before requesting a skylight replacement, homeowners should consider the size, style, and placement of the new skylight to ensure it complements their property’s architecture. It’s also helpful to understand the condition of the surrounding roof and how the new installation might impact existing roof structures or insulation. Clarifying preferences for natural light levels, ventilation, and energy efficiency can help guide the selection of the most suitable skylight type and features for the space.

Common Home Skylight Replacement Jobs
Home Skylight Replacement - Upgrading outdated or damaged skylights to enhance natural light and energy efficiency.
Skylight Repair - Fixing leaks, cracks, or condensation issues to restore proper function.
Skylight Seal Replacement - Replacing worn or damaged seals to prevent water intrusion and improve insulation.
Skylight Frame Replacement - Updating or repairing the frame to ensure stability and proper fit.
Skylight Flashing Replacement - Replacing or repairing flashing to prevent leaks around the skylight opening.
Custom Skylight Installation - Installing new skylights tailored to specific roof types and homeowner preferences.
Home Skylight Replacement Questions
What are common reasons to replace a skylight? Skylights may need replacement due to leaks, cracks, condensation, or reduced energy efficiency.
How can I tell if my skylight needs replacement? Signs include water stains, drafts, persistent condensation, or visible damage on the skylight frame or glass.
What types of skylights are available for replacement? Options include fixed, vented, or tubular skylights, each suited to different lighting and ventilation needs.
Is professional installation necessary for skylight replacement? Yes, proper installation ensures the skylight is sealed correctly and functions as intended, preventing leaks and drafts.
